About Romania (RO)

Country associated with unparalleled beauty, medieval town, deep-rooted traditional culture, delightful architecture and fictional Dracula, makes Romania an underrated travel destination! Explore the dynamic capital city Bucharest, also called “Little Paris”; home to countless ruin bars, museums, and restaurants. To get a feel of the authentic vampire town, visit Brasov; nestled at the base of the Carpathian Mountains and full of 17th century gothic architecture, medieval charm and cobbled streets and alleys. Tour the Black Church, take a cable car or hike up the Tampa Mountain, clamber around Brasov Citadel, take a day trip to Bran and Peles Castle. Cluj-Napoca is a cultural and historic hub and has some of Romania’s best churches, cathedrals, museums, and a beautiful opera house. Bran, an old town with a fortress overlooking the Transylvania region & the home of Dracula’s castle (Bran Castle). Visit the UNESCO protected Fairy Tale Town of Sighisoara; a charming town with gothic architecture, also the birthplace of Vlad the Impaler (inspiration for Dracula character). See the natural sphinx of the Bucegi Mountains or visit the world’s happiest cemetery in Sapanta, or some of the UNESCO protected wooden churches of Maramures. Take a magical and romantic stream train through a mountain pass or a road trip to drive through the Carpathian Mountains. The Transfăgărășan Pass is one of the most famous drives in Europe, with spectacular views and hairpin turns.
